I have just had a tour in the Middle of VN:

Heaven cave (Paradise cave, Thien duong cave) is a real cave in National Park Phong Nha - Ke Bang , Son Trach commune , Bo Trach District , Quang Binh Province. The cave is located in the forest zones of ecological restoration , limestone core zone of the national park of Phong Nha - Ke Bang . Paradise Cave was discovered in 2005 , the Royal Association of British cave discovered in 2005-2010 and in 2010 they announced this cave has a total length of 31.4 km (just 1km walkway to visit inside cave) , the longest cave in Asia. Due to the beauty of stalactites and stalagmites in the cave , they have named this cave is Heaven .
According to the Association of the British Cave Research , Heaven cave was big and beautiful than the Phong Nha cave . Heaven is a dry cave, no underground river flows through as the Phong Nha .
According to a preliminary survey of scientists , compared with the Phong Nha cave , then Heaven and length scales much larger . Heaven cave has many stalactites and stalagmites block magic . Most of this soil is soil plasticity , quite flat so convenient for sightseeing and exploring . The temperature inside the cave Heaven is always different from the outside about 16 ° C.
